Output 51e8f1abd4316406da5cd3fc3e6d55e376fc8f2d0cc43be751f68b276482a28a:3

value
362181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b7739c9791f8828ab3a4ac06476d08475e4397a OP_EQUAL
address
3A2eEx1iAwcRELtYwvNs4nARi4wfsSgV12
transaction
51e8f1abd4316406da5cd3fc3e6d55e376fc8f2d0cc43be751f68b276482a28a
spent
true